Mediterranean Chicken Meatballs with Tzatziki

Yield: 4

Mediterranean Chicken Meatballs with Tzatziki

Mediterranean Chicken Meatballs with Tzatziki are juicy, herb-packed bites bursting with fresh, vibrant flavor.

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es

Ingredients

  • Chicken Meatballs:
  • 1½ pounds ground chicken
  • ½ cup plain breadcrumbs
  • 1 large egg
  • ¼ cup finely diced red onion
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• ¼ cup f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• ½ teaspoon ground cumin
  • Zest of 1 lemon
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• ¾ te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• Tzatziki Sauce:
  • 1 cup plain Greek yogurt
  • ½ cup grated cucumber, squeezed dry
  • 1 tablespoon fresh dill,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• Salt to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. In a large bowl, combine all meatball ingredients. Mix gently until just combined.
  3. Roll into 1½-inch meatballs and place on prepared baking sheet.
  4. Bake 18–20 minutes, until cooked through (internal temperature 165°F/74°C).
    Alternatively, pan-sear in olive oil over medium heat for 10–12 minutes, turning occasionally.
  5. For tzatziki, stir together yogurt, cucumber, dill, lemon juice, garlic, and salt. Chill until ready to serve.
  6. Serve meatballs warm with tzatziki on the side or drizzled on top.

Notes

  • Make it gluten-free by using gluten-free breadcrumbs.
  • Add crumbled feta to the meatball mixture for extra flavor.

Mediterranean Chicken Meatballs with Tzatziki are juicy, herb-packed bites bursting with fresh, vibrant flavor. Ground chicken is blended with garlic, red onion, parsley, oregano, and a hint of lemon zest, then baked or pan-seared until golden and tender.

These lighter meatballs stay moist and flavorful, thanks to a touch of olive oil and simple Mediterranean spices. Paired with cool, creamy tzatziki made from Greek yogurt, cucumber, dill, and lemon, the contrast is refreshing and satisfying. Serve them as an appetizer with toothpicks, tuck them into warm pita bread, or build a nourishing bowl with rice, tomatoes, and olives. They’re perfect for meal prep and reheat beautifully throughout the week. Whether for a casual family dinner or entertaining guests, this recipe delivers bright, wholesome flavors inspired by the Mediterranean coast.
